I really enjoyed this show. It's a little cheesy sometimes and some action scenes feel very slow and unsuspenseful, also the guy who plays Elvis is not the strongest actor, but apart from that it was great. Solid and interesting world building (the fact that this show is set in Mexico and therefore brings in culturally specific supernatural elements made it even more interesting) , cool characters (I especially liked Nancy) and a good story.
I would say this was one of the best supernatural shows of the last few years. The first one since the early seasons of Supernatural and season 1 of Wynona Earp that really hooked me. I am super excited for a second season, hopefully we will get one. This could be great!
This supernatural, demon-hunting show is dumb, I can't really pretend otherwise, but that doesn't mean I didn't like it. I found it entertaining enough to ignore the terrible effects and general cheesiness. This was largely due to the character of Nancy (the charismatic Giselle Kuri), a troubled but lovable demon-channeler who effortlessly steals every scene she's in.
Season 2 was also silly fun, and though shorter, I feel like season 1 should've been 6 episodes as well, to cut some of the fat.
Overall, turn your brain off and this is an amusing show that's perfectly self-aware as to its goofy nature. I feel like it should be viewed in subtitled form only, but that's me.
